3. What is the major difference between matter at the nanoscale and matter at larger scales such as millimeters or inches?

Correct answer: B

Rationale: The correct answer is B. Matter at the nanoscale exhibits unique and special characteristics that distinguish it from matter at larger scales. This can include properties like increased surface area, different melting points, altered conductivity, and enhanced reactivity. Choice A is incorrect as metals at the nanoscale can be more rigid compared to their larger scale counterparts. Choice C is incorrect because matter at the nanoscale has properties that are distinct from both atomic and larger scales. Choice D is incorrect as there are significant differences in how matter behaves and interacts at the nanoscale compared to larger scales.
